Title: Anderson José Ferreira: Innovator in Cardiovascular Research
Introduction
Anderson José Ferreira is a notable inventor based in Belo Horizonte, Brazil. He has made significant contributions to the field of cardiovascular research through his innovative work on peptide compounds. His research focuses on developing new methods for treating and preventing diseases related to cardiovascular health.
Latest Patents
Anderson José Ferreira holds a patent for the peptide Des-[Asp]-[Ala]-Angiotensin-(1-7) (Ala-Arg-Val-Tyr-Ile-His-Pro) (SEQ ID NO: 1). This invention is related to its use as a vasodilating and cardioprotective agent in mammals. The patent also encompasses the production of compounds containing Des-[Asp]-[Ala]-Angiotensin-(1-7) and its related compounds, highlighting their potential in therapeutic applications.
Career Highlights
Anderson is affiliated with the Universidade Federal De Minas Gerais, where he contributes to research and education in the field of health sciences. His work has garnered attention for its potential impact on improving cardiovascular treatments.
Collaborations
He has collaborated with notable colleagues, including Robson Augusto Souza Dos Santos and Rubén Dario Sinisterra, enhancing the scope and depth of his research endeavors.
